Day 1 Activities
A thrilling adventure awaits on Day 1 of the "Mountain Trek & Local Villages Overnight Tour." After an 8:00 AM hotel pickup, travelers set off to trek the Longhut trail, which covers 13 kilometers and typically takes 6 to 8 hours, depending on conditions. Along the way, they cross the Nam Khan River by boat, hike through breathtaking canyons, and enjoy local village life.
Activity | Details |
---|---|
Start Time | 8:00 AM hotel pickup |
Trail Distance | 13 kilometers |
Trek Duration | 6 to 8 hours, depending on conditions |
River Crossing | Boat ride across Nam Khan River |
Evening Homestay | Dinner and stay in Khmu village |

Day 2 Highlights
Kicking off Day 2, participants enjoy a hearty breakfast before setting out for a 1.5 to 2-hour trek to the Hmong village of Ban Tin Pha.
This scenic hike offers a glimpse into local life and stunning landscapes, setting the tone for an adventurous day.
Highlights include:
- Trekking downhill to Ban Houay Yen, surrounded by lush greenery.
- Local boat ride to the breathtaking Tad Sae Waterfalls.
- A chance to swim in the refreshing waters after the trek.
- Enjoying lunch at a village or by the waterfall, soaking in nature.
- Cultural immersion through interactions with friendly villagers.

Inclusions and Exclusions
After a day filled with trekking and cultural experiences, participants can look forward to a well-rounded package that enhances their journey.
The tour includes a comprehensive two-day guided experience, complete with all entrance fees and an English-speaking guide. Travelers benefit from hotel pickup and drop-off, delicious meals, local transportation, and homestay fees, ensuring a smooth adventure into the heart of local culture.
However, it’s important to note what’s not included. Participants should plan for additional drinks and snacks, as well as tips for guides.
This tour isn’t suitable for those with mobility impairments or seasickness, so guests should evaluate their physical readiness before embarking on this enriching experience in Luang Prabang.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is the Best Time of Year for This Tour?
For optimal experience, travelers should visit between November and February. During these months, temperatures are cooler, rainfall is minimal, and the scenery is vibrant, ensuring a comfortable trek and enriching cultural interactions in local villages.
Are There Age Restrictions for Participants on the Trek?
The trek’s age restrictions aren’t strictly defined, but participants should be fit and able to handle moderate hiking. Families often enjoy it, though younger children might find the trek challenging. Preparation is key for everyone.
